Abstract

A payment two-dimensional code generation system and a secure transaction method comprise the following steps: an input section for inputting payment information; the two-dimensional code transcoding part is used for converting the payment information into an original two-dimensional code pattern at a fixed fault-tolerant rate; a characteristic pattern input section for inputting a characteristic pattern; the characteristic pattern embedding part is used for enabling the area proportion of the characteristic patterns embedded into the original two-dimensional code patterns to be slightly larger than the fixed fault-tolerant rate so as to form middle two-dimensional code patterns; a two-dimensional code pattern correcting part for correcting part of points of the characteristic pattern in the middle two-dimensional code image to enable the area occupation ratio of different areas of the formed pay two-dimensional code pattern and the code element in the original two-dimensional code image to be smaller than the fixed fault-tolerant rate by a specific threshold value; and the printing part is used for printing the generated payment two-dimensional code pattern to generate the payment two-dimensional code on the printing medium.

Payment two-dimensional code safe transaction method
Technical Field
The invention relates to a two-dimensional code printing technology, in particular to a payment two-dimensional code printing system.
Background
The two-dimensional code is a bar code which records data symbol information by black and white figures distributed on a two-dimensional plane according to a certain rule by using a certain specific geometric figure, can transmit required information after being scanned by equipment, and is expanded on the basis of a one-dimensional bar code technology and has readability. The two-dimensional code has the characteristics of high capacity, high reliability, strong error correction capability, high confidentiality and the like. At present, the method is widely applied to the aspects of mobile phone electronic certificates, check anti-counterfeiting, invoice anti-counterfeiting and the like.
With the rapid development of the internet of things technology and the mobile communication technology, the two-dimensional code payment is taken as the main force of mobile payment, the payment field is widely popularized by means of fashionable and convenient customer experience, the increase of the number of users is very rapid, and the two-dimensional code payment is rapidly integrated into the society and daily life of people.
Various two-dimensional code application technologies based on two-dimensional code payment, two-dimensional code electronic certificates and two-dimensional code encrypted invoices enable business and life experiences to become more active. Many people are gradually accustomed to code-scanning payments when shopping or consuming small amounts. The intelligent mobile phone scans the two-dimension code provided by the merchant, and transfers money from the payment account or the WeChat account of the intelligent mobile phone to the account of the merchant, so that money payment is completed.
In the two-dimensional code payment, after the two-dimensional code of paying is printed out through the printer to the trade company, set up in goods shelves or cashier's office, when the customer need pay, through the payment two-dimensional code that the mobile device scanning printed out to carry out currency payment. This provides a ride for criminals while providing transaction convenience for merchants and customers. According to reports, many criminals replace payment two-dimensional code information printed by merchants with the payment two-dimensional code information of the criminals, so that cases that users pay money are stolen.
In order to find that the payment two-dimensional code information is replaced by criminals in time, in the prior art, when the payment two-dimensional code is printed, a specific characteristic image such as a merchant photo is arranged in the middle of the two-dimensional code, and whether the payment two-dimensional code information is replaced or not is judged by observing whether the characteristic image exists or not. However, the payment two-dimensional code images are public, criminals can insert the characteristic images into the counterfeit payment two-dimensional code images after photographing the characteristic images, and the counterfeit payment two-dimensional code images are printed to replace the payment two-dimensional code images of merchants, so that the merchants are difficult to find the safety problems of the payment two-dimensional codes in time.
In the prior art, 201410623487.9, 201410839169.6, 201220014626.4, 201520283696.3 and other patents disclose anti-counterfeiting two-dimensional code printing devices, but these devices are not used for printing payment two-dimensional codes, and the printed two-dimensional codes cannot solve the above problems.
In order to solve the above problems, a payment two-dimensional code printing system is previously applied, and a feature image with an area ratio larger than a fault tolerance rate is set in a payment two-dimensional code, so that a printed payment two-dimensional code image is difficult to replace, and the payment security of the two-dimensional code is improved; however, when the identification of the printed payment two-dimensional code fails, it cannot be determined whether the two-dimensional code is replaced or whether the two-dimensional code is another reason.
Disclosure of Invention
The invention provides a payment two-dimensional code generation system and a transaction method as further improvement, and whether a payment two-dimensional code is replaced or not can be judged when the payment two-dimensional code identification fails.
As an aspect of the present invention, there is provided a payment two-dimensional code printing system including: an input section for inputting payment information; the two-dimensional code transcoding part is used for converting the payment information into an original two-dimensional code pattern at a fixed fault-tolerant rate; a characteristic pattern input section for inputting a characteristic pattern; a characteristic pattern embedding part which enlarges or reduces the characteristic pattern according to the fixed fault-tolerant rate to enable the area ratio of the characteristic pattern embedded into the original two-dimensional code pattern to be slightly larger than the fixed fault-tolerant rate and form a middle two-dimensional code pattern; the two-dimensional code pattern correction part corrects partial points of the characteristic pattern in the middle two-dimensional code image according to the original two-dimensional code image, so that the area occupation ratio of different areas of code elements in the formed payment two-dimensional code pattern and the original two-dimensional code image is smaller than the fixed fault-tolerant rate by a specific threshold value; and the printing part is used for printing the generated payment two-dimensional code pattern to generate the payment two-dimensional code on the printing medium.
As another aspect of the present invention, there is provided a secure transaction method for a payment two-dimensional code printed by the payment two-dimensional code printing system, including: the method comprises the following steps: (1) storing the fixed fault tolerance; (2) scanning the payment two-dimensional code to obtain a payment two-dimensional code image; (3) identifying the payment two-dimensional code image, and entering the step (4) if the payment two-dimensional code image cannot be identified; if the payment two-dimensional code image can be identified, identifying and entering the step (5); (4) acquiring a format information area image of the payment two-dimensional code image; (4.1) identifying the payment two-dimensional code image format information area image, and acquiring payment two-dimensional code image format information; (4.2) judging whether the error correction level in the payment two-dimensional code image format information is equal to the fixed fault-tolerant rate, if so, giving two-dimensional code identification failure information, and ending the identification process; if the fault-tolerant rate is not equal to the fixed fault-tolerant rate, a prompt that the payment two-dimensional code is unsafe is given, and the identification process is ended; (5) acquiring the payment two-dimension code information; (6) judging whether the set fault tolerance rate is equal to the fixed fault tolerance rate or not according to the error correction level information of the payment two-dimensional code, and entering the step (7) if the set fault tolerance rate is not equal to the fixed fault tolerance rate; if the fault tolerance rate is equal to the fixed fault tolerance rate, entering the step (8); (7) giving a prompt that the payment two-dimensional code is unsafe, and ending the identification process; (8) determining that the payment two-dimension code information is safe two-dimension code payment information; (9) and carrying out payment according to the payment two-dimensional code information.

The payment two-dimensional code printing system comprises an input part, a two-dimensional code transcoding part, a characteristic pattern input part, a characteristic pattern embedding part, a two-dimensional code pattern correcting part and a printing part.
The input part is used for inputting payment information of the payment two-dimensional code, and the payment information can be a payment website of a payment platform. The payment information can be input through a wireless network, a wired network or a storage medium, and can also be input through a man-machine interaction device such as a keyboard, a touch screen and the like.
And a two-dimensional code transcoding part for converting the payment information into an original two-dimensional code pattern as shown in fig. 1 (a) at a fixed fault tolerance rate. The payment information may be assembled into the original two-dimensional code image using conventional two-dimensional code encoding rules, such as QR, Data Matrix, PDF417, and the like. The fixed fault tolerance may be, for example, 7%, 15%, or higher. In the following embodiments, a fixed fault tolerance of 15% is taken as an example. The original two-dimensional code image can be black and white, and a color two-dimensional code with mixed dark color and light color can also be adopted.
The characteristic pattern input part is used for inputting characteristic patterns, and the characteristic images can be merchant marks, trademarks, figures, symbols, landscapes and the like. The characteristic pattern is used for being placed in the two-dimensional code image, so that a merchant can find the printed two-dimensional code in time when the printed two-dimensional code is replaced by a lawless person. The feature image may be black and white or color, where it may be binarized and then set using the same color as the original two-dimensional code image.
And a feature image embedding unit which enlarges or reduces the feature pattern according to the fixed fault tolerance of the two-dimensional code transcoding unit, so that the area occupation ratio of the feature pattern embedded in the original two-dimensional code pattern is larger than the fixed fault tolerance, for example, the area occupation ratio of the feature pattern can be higher than the fixed fault tolerance by 2-5%. For example, the feature image of the feature pattern input unit may occupy 10% of the area of the original two-dimensional code pattern, and the feature image may be enlarged by 70%, so that the enlarged feature image occupies 17% of the area of the original two-dimensional code pattern, and is 2% higher than the fixed fault-tolerance rate of 15%. The enlarged or reduced feature image is embedded into the original two-dimensional code pattern to form an intermediate two-dimensional code pattern as shown in fig. 1 (b), where the embedding location may be the center or other data area of the payment two-dimensional code.
The two-dimensional code pattern correction section corrects a part of points of the feature pattern in the middle two-dimensional code image according to the original two-dimensional code image, for example, as shown in fig. 1 (c), and corrects a part of symbols in the face feature pattern of fig. 1 (b) so that the part of symbols is the same as the symbols at the positions of the part of symbols in the original two-dimensional code image, so that the area of the different regions of the formed pay two-dimensional code pattern and the symbols in the original two-dimensional code image is smaller than the fixed fault tolerance by a specific threshold, which may be set to, for example, 2% to 4%. For example, the formed payment two-dimensional code image can be identified by modifying the characteristic part code element to make the area ratio of different areas of the code element in the formed payment two-dimensional code pattern and the original two-dimensional code image be 12 percent, which is less than the fixed fault tolerance rate of 15 percent.
A printing part including a printing cartridge, the cartridge being a black cartridge or a color cartridge. The printing section is configured to print the generated payment two-dimensional code pattern to generate a payment two-dimensional code on a printing medium, for example, printing paper. After the payment two-dimensional code is printed out, the payment two-dimensional code is arranged on a goods shelf or a cash register, and when a customer needs to pay, the payment two-dimensional code printed out through scanning of the mobile equipment is scanned, so that money payment is carried out.
The secure identification method of the payment two-dimensional code of the embodiment of the invention, as shown in figure 2, comprises the following steps: (1) storing the fixed fault tolerance; (2) scanning the payment two-dimensional code to obtain a payment two-dimensional code image; (3) identifying the payment two-dimensional code image, and entering the step (4) if the payment two-dimensional code image cannot be identified; if the payment two-dimensional code image can be identified, identifying and entering the step (5); (4) acquiring a Format Information (Format Information) area image of the payment two-dimensional code image; (4.1) identifying the payment two-dimensional code image format information area image, and acquiring payment two-dimensional code image format information; (4.2) judging whether an Error Correction Level (Error Correction Level) in the payment two-dimensional code image format information is equal to the fixed fault-tolerant rate, if so, giving two-dimensional code identification failure information, and ending the identification process; if the fault-tolerant rate is not equal to the fixed fault-tolerant rate, a prompt that the payment two-dimensional code is unsafe is given, and the identification process is ended; (5) acquiring the payment two-dimension code information; (6) judging whether the set fault tolerance rate is equal to the fixed fault tolerance rate or not according to the error correction level information of the payment two-dimensional code, and entering the step (7) if the set fault tolerance rate is not equal to the fixed fault tolerance rate; if the fault tolerance rate is equal to the fixed fault tolerance rate, entering the step (8); (7) giving a prompt that the payment two-dimensional code is unsafe, and ending the identification process; (8) and determining that the payment two-dimension code information is safe two-dimension code payment information.
When the payment two-dimensional code printed by the payment two-dimensional code printing system is transacted, if the two-dimensional code image cannot be identified, the format information area in the two-dimensional code image is further acquired, and the error correction level of the format information area is judged, so that whether the payment two-dimensional code cannot be identified is determined.
